✨ lux

A friendly CLI wrapper for g213-led to control Logitech G213 Prodigy keyboard lighting with presets, gradients, and more.

Features

  • 🏳️ Named presets — Apply country flags, royal colors, and special effects with simple names
  • 🎨 Custom colors — Set any RGB hex color
  • Gradients — Smooth color transitions across keyboard zones
  • 🔄 Rotation mode — Cycle through presets automatically
  • 🎲 Random mode — Surprise yourself with random colors, gradients, or presets
  • 🏷️ Aliases — Multiple names for the same preset (e.g., USA, Murica, FREEDOM 🦅)

Requirements

  • Python 3.10+
  • g213-led installed and in PATH

Installation

Usage

Apply a preset

lux Slovakia          # 🇸🇰 Slovak flag (also: slovakia, Slovensko, slovensko)
lux Vatican           # 🇻🇦 Vatican flag (also: Vaticano)
lux royal-blue        # 🔵 Solid color

List all presets

lux -l
lux --list

Custom RGB color

lux -rh ff0000        # 🔴 Solid red
lux --rgbhex 00ff00   # 🟢 Solid green

Gradient

lux -g ff0000 0000ff        # 🔴 ➜ 🔵 Red to blue
lux --gradient ff0000 0000ff
lux -g ff0000 0000ff -v     # Verbose: shows each zone color

Random mode

lux -R                # 🎰 Full surprise: random preset, color, zones, or gradient
lux -R flag           # 🏳️ Random flag preset
lux -R color          # 🎨 Random color preset
lux -R preset         # Random preset from all categories
lux -R -v             # Verbose: shows what was picked

Rotation mode

lux -r flags          # Cycle through all flag presets
lux -r colors         # Cycle through all color presets
lux -r flags -i 3     # 3 second interval (default: 5)
lux -r flags -v       # Verbose: shows current preset

Options

Option Short Description
--list -l List all available presets
--rgbhex RRGGBB -rh Apply raw RGB hex color
--gradient LEFT RIGHT -g Apply gradient between two colors
--random [CATEGORY] -R Random mode (flag/color/preset/all)
--rotate CATEGORY -r Rotate through presets (flags/colors)
--interval SECONDS -i Rotation interval (default: 5)
--verbose -v Show detailed output

Adding a preset

Edit lux_core/presets.py and add to _PRESET_DEFINITIONS:

# Solid color
{
    "aliases": ["my-color", "mycolor"],
    "description": "Optional description",
    "category": PresetCategory.COLOR,
    "type": "solid",
    "color": "ff00ff",
},

# Multi-zone (5 zones, left to right)
{
    "aliases": ["my-flag"],
    "description": "My country flag",
    "category": PresetCategory.FLAG,
    "type": "regions",
    "colors": ["ff0000", "ffffff", "0000ff", "ffffff", "ff0000"],
},

Categories: PresetCategory.FLAG, PresetCategory.COLOR, PresetCategory.SPECIAL

How it works

lux is a thin wrapper around g213-led. It translates presets into g213-led commands:

  • Solid colors: g213-led -a RRGGBB
  • Per-zone colors: g213-led -r 1 COLOR1 && g213-led -r 2 COLOR2 ...

The keyboard has 5 lighting zones (left to right).
